1. Understanding How Solar Energy Heats Water

Solar energy heats water through a simple yet effective process that utilizes the sun’s radiation. A solar water heaterconsists of solar collectors that absorb sunlight and transfer heat to the water stored in a tank. Let’s break down the working principle in detail.

1.1 Solar Collectors: Capturing Sunlight

The solar collectors are the most crucial components of a solar water heater. These panels, typically installed on rooftops, absorb the sun’s heat and transfer it to the water flowing through pipes. The two main types of collectors used are:

  • Flat Plate Collectors (FPC): These consist of an insulated box with a dark absorber plate that collects heat and transfers it to water.
  • Evacuated Tube Collectors (ETC): These use vacuum-sealed glass tubes that enhance heat absorption, making them more efficient in colder climates.

1.2 Heat Transfer Mechanism

Once the collectors absorb sunlight, the heat is transferred to the water circulating within the system. This process occurs in two primary ways:

  • Direct Circulation: Water flows directly through the solar collectors, gets heated, and is stored in a tank for use.
  • Indirect Circulation: A heat transfer fluid (usually antifreeze) is heated in the collectors and then passes through a heat exchanger, warming the water without mixing with it.

1.3 Storage and Usage

The heated water is stored in an insulated tank to prevent heat loss. Whenever hot water is needed, it flows from the storage tank to taps, showers, or appliances, providing a consistent supply of warm water throughout the day.

2. Types of Solar Water Heaters

There are different types of solar water heaters, each designed to suit varying climates, energy needs, and budgets.

2.1 Passive vs. Active Solar Water Heaters

Passive Solar Water Heaters

  • Operate without pumps or external power.
  • Rely on gravity and natural convection to circulate water.
  • More affordable but slightly less efficient than active systems.

Active Solar Water Heaters

  • Use pumps to circulate water or heat-transfer fluid.
  • Provide faster heating and work well in areas with fluctuating temperatures.
  • Require minimal electricity for circulation but offer greater efficiency.

2.2 Pressurized vs. Non-Pressurized Solar Water Heaters

Pressurized Solar Water Heaters

  • Provide consistent water pressure, making them ideal for multi-story buildings.
  • Suitable for modern homes and commercial applications.

Non-Pressurized Solar Water Heaters

  • Use gravity-based water flow.
  • More affordable and best for single-story homes or areas with stable water supply.

4. Tips to Maximize Solar Water Heater Efficiency

To get the most out of your solar water heater, follow these simple tips:

4.1 Proper Installation and Positioning

Ensure that the solar collectors are installed at an optimal angle to maximize sunlight absorption. Varistor Solar experts can help you determine the best positioning for your system.

4.2 Regular Maintenance

Keep the collectors clean and check for any blockages or leaks. A well-maintained solar water heater operates more efficiently and lasts longer.

4.3 Insulation Matters

Make sure that the storage tank and pipes are well-insulated to minimize heat loss, especially in colder regions.

4.4 Use Hot Water Wisely

To maximize savings, use hot water during peak sunlight hours. This ensures that you get the most efficient heating from your solar water heater.
